Chad's Story

Life This is what it has come to I fill out a bio to see what my classmates have been up to for the last 20 plus years. Short and sweet I couldn’t find my direction in college so I joined an electrical apprenticeship in 1985. I ended up in Indiana in 1988 to finish my apprenticeship, building the Subaru/Isuzu car plant in Lafayette. I found my true love a young lady (and a daughter Lindsey nine years old) from Oklahoma in Lafayette. She was an apprentice electrician at the time as I. We traveled a bit working in the Upper Peninsula of Michigan and parts of Wisconsin ending up back in Lafayette.
